Transaction 2c108588aeea6be66ab283ac87cbcff334601934b2eee764c02974bba172b549

1 Input
2 Outputs
  • 2c108588aeea6be66ab283ac87cbcff334601934b2eee764c02974bba172b549:0
  • value  29334846
    address  37uZgz4KMNdQEeFnRnYQijdviwV9GHvbJ5
  • 2c108588aeea6be66ab283ac87cbcff334601934b2eee764c02974bba172b549:1
  • value  71903645
    address  1EQKYsCkvg3QpwcLWMEVVwB4W3CJ5B1c6C